How To Fix /IBX/PE_FILE_SRV037 - Cannot determine file name


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/IBX/PE_FILE_SRV -

  • Message number: 037

  • Message text: Cannot determine file name

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/IBX/PE_FILE_SRV037 - Cannot determine file name ?

    The SAP error message /IBX/PE_FILE_SRV037 Cannot determine file name typically occurs in the context of file handling or file processing within the SAP system, particularly when using the SAP Business Technology Platform or related services. This error indicates that the system is unable to identify or locate the file name that is required for a specific operation.

    Causes:

    1. Missing File Name: The file name may not have been provided in the request or configuration.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: There may be an issue with the configuration settings related to file handling in the application or service.
    3. File Path Issues: The path to the file may be incorrect or inaccessible due to permissions or other restrictions.
    4. Data Transfer Issues: If the file is being transferred from another system or location, there may be issues with the transfer process.
    5. System Bugs: There could be bugs or issues in the specific version of the SAP software being used.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Input Parameters: Ensure that the file name is being correctly passed in the request. If you are using a program or function module, verify that all required parameters are being provided.
    2. Review Configuration: Check the configuration settings related to file handling in the relevant SAP application.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ly defined.
    3. Verify File Path: If the file is expected to be located in a specific directory, verify that the path is correct and that the file exists in that location.
    4. Permissions Check: Ensure that the user or service account has the necessary permissions to access the file or directory.
    5. Debugging: If you have access to the development environment, consider debugging the program or function that is generating the error to identify where the file name is being lost or not set.
    6.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ation or notes related to the specific module or service you are using for any known issues or additional troubleshooting steps.
    7.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and you cannot determine the cause,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ance.

    Related Information:

    • SAP Notes: Check SAP Notes for any known issues or patches related to this error message.
    • Transaction Codes: Familiarize yourself with relevant transaction codes that may help in troubleshooting file handling issues, such as AL11 (for file directories) or SM37 (for job monitoring).
    • Logs and Traces: Review application logs and traces for additional error messages or context that may help in diagnosing the issue.
